•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Excel Sayfasındaki Metin kutularına Textboxtaki Değerleri Yazdırma

  • Konbuyu başlatan Konbuyu başlatan ahmedummu
  • Başlangıç tarihi Başlangıç tarihi
A

ahmedummu

Misafir
Merhaba arkadaşlar,

Excel sayfasındaki metin kutularına textlerdeki değerleri yazdırmak istiyorum. Mümkünse döngü ile yazdırmak istiyorum. Örnek dosyayı ekliyorum. Yardımcı olursanız sevinirim.
 

Ekli dosyalar

Merhaba,

Metin kutusu 9'u Metin kutusu 8 olarak düzeltiniz.


Kod:
Private Sub CommandButton1_Click()
With Sheets("Sayfa1")
    For i = 1 To 8
        .Shapes("metin kutusu " & i & "").TextFrame.Characters.Text = Me("TextBox" & i)
    Next i
End With
End Sub
 
Ziynettin bey çok teşekkür ederim.

Bunların içini nasıl temizleyebiliriz.

Bir de 4 Adet optionbuttonum var.
optionbutton1 seçili ise 1-20 arasındaki metin kutularına,
optionbutton2 seçili ise 21-40 arasındaki metin kutularına,
optionbutton3 seçili ise 41-60 arasındaki metin kutularına,
optionbutton4 seçili ise 61-80 arasındaki metin kutularına textlerin değerlerini yazdırmak istiyorum.

Şu an textlerimin sayısı 8 fakat bunlar çoğalacak.
 
Textlerin içini temizleme çözüldü fakat diğer konuda yardımcı olursanız sevinirim.
 
Bu şekilde kullanabilirsiniz.

Kod:
Private Sub CommandButton1_Click()
If OptionButton1 = True Then: basla = 1: son = 20
If OptionButton2 = True Then: basla = 21: son = 40
If OptionButton3 = True Then: basla = 41: son = 60
If OptionButton4 = True Then: basla = 61: son = 80
With Sheets("Sayfa1")
    For i = basla To son
        say = say + 1
        .Shapes("metin kutusu " & i & "").TextFrame.Characters.Text = Me("TextBox" & say)
    Next i
End With
End Sub
 
Çok teşekkür ederim Ziynettin bey.
 
Geri
Üst